Незаменимые практические советы по написанию кода в устойчивом темпе и по управлению сложностью, из-за которой проекты часто выходят из-под контроля. В книге описываются методы и процессы, позволяющие решать ключевые вопросы: от создания чек-листов до организации командной работы, от инкапсуляции до декомпозиции, от проектирования API до модульного тестирования. Автор иллюстрирует свои выводы фрагментами кода, взятых из готового проекта. Написанные на языке C#, они будут понятны всем, кто использует любой объектно-ориентированный язык, включая Java, C++ и TypeScript. Для более глубокого изучения материала вы можете загрузить весь код и подробные комментарии к коммитам.
- -15%
Роберт Мартин рекомендует. Код, который умещается в голове: эвристики для разработчиков
Купили 53 человека
Описание и характеристики
5 причин купить эту книгу:
- 1. Книгу рекомендует сам Роберт Мартин!
- 2. Выберете образ мышления и процессы, которые работают, и научитесь избегать плохих неработающих метафор.
- 3. Задействуете чек-листы, чтобы высвободить когнитивные ресурсы и улучшить результаты с помощью уже имеющихся навыков.
- 4. Избавитесь от "аналитического паралича", создав и развернув вертикальный срез своего приложения.
- 5. Овладеете лучшими методами изменения поведения кода.
- Тип обложки Мягкий переплёт
- Количество страниц 400
- Вес, г 628
- Размер 2.1x16.5x23.3
- Издательство Питер
- Серия Библиотека программиста
- Возрастные ограничения 16+
- Год издания 2024
- ISBN 978-5-4461-2293-6
- Тираж 400
- ID товара 2982095